A’ja Wilson came up clutch for Las Vegas in the team’s 95-79 win over Dallas on Sunday.
The Aces forward neared triple-double territory in the victory, recording 22 points, 13 rebounds and eight assists. It was also the ninth time Wilson has scored 20 or more points in a game this season.

Dearica Hamby put up big numbers for the Aces, as well. The first-time All-Star finished with 22 points and 12 rebounds on 69.2 percent shooting.

The Aces are now 2-0 against the Wings in the regular season.
Next up: Las Vegas will face the Mystics following the Olympic break on Aug. 15. The Wings will next host the Sun on Aug. 15.
